Oct. 21--MAN IS TOP DOG AS IT SNAPS UP GNI: Hedge fund specialist Man Group hailed itself as the world's largest independent futures broker after snapping up London-based GNI for UKpound 100 million in cash today. Man has bought the business from South African financial services group Old Mutual, which acquired it as part of the Gerrard Group in January 2000. GNI employs 500 people but some jobs will go.
